Ambidieztro – Master Two Characters at the Same Time
Ambidieztro isn't the kind of game that only requires quick reflexes or memorizing simple controls. The game puts players on an extremely unique challenge: controlling two characters simultaneously with two separate hands.
One hand uses the WASD keys, the other uses the arrow keys. It sounds simple for the first few seconds, but the longer you play, the more your brain becomes "overloaded" by having to process two completely independent movements.
This rare gameplay mechanism is what sets Ambidieztro apart from the multitude of typical skill-based games.

Simple Controls, Complex Execution
- WASD: Control the character on the left
- Arrow Keys: Control the character on the right
- TAB: Restart the game
